Transaction 3b106099c70dbc61e4c11074b3ee62e3352a295d4a5118fec913f9588e250bf6
1 Input
1 Output
-
3b106099c70dbc61e4c11074b3ee62e3352a295d4a5118fec913f9588e250bf6:0
- value
- 1297102
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ac5b10530da962214dcf1dfd3e1e548c1ffd6e07 OP_EQUAL
- address
- 3HQMEm36if26izJjLjic95q9XFiQYzFJ9Y